Tanzania Safari Experience: Where to Go and Why It’s Worth It

A Tanzania Safari Experience offers breathtaking wildlife encounters, stunning landscapes, and unforgettable moments in some of Africa’s most iconic national parks.

To begin with, a Tanzania Safari Experience places you right in the middle of the extraordinary Great Migration, which draws travelers from across the globe. Every year, millions of wildebeest, zebras, and gazelles move across the vast plains of the Serengeti National Park in search of fresh grazing. As a result, you witness dramatic river crossings, intense predator action, and constantly changing scenery, while each moment feels raw, powerful, and completely unforgettable.

Tanzania Safari Experience: Unmatched Wildlife Diversity

Moreover, Tanzania delivers exceptional wildlife density, which makes every game drive rewarding from start to finish. In fact, you can spot lions, elephants, leopards, buffalo, and rhinos within a short period, especially in areas like the Ngorongoro Crater. Because this natural enclosure supports a rich ecosystem, animals remain visible throughout the year, while guides track movement with impressive precision. Consequently, you enjoy consistent sightings and gain a deeper appreciation for the balance of nature.

Tanzania Safari Experience: Diverse and Stunning Landscapes

In addition, Tanzania offers remarkable landscape diversity, which keeps your journey visually engaging every single day. While you explore the endless plains of the Serengeti National Park, you also encounter lush crater floors, ancient baobab trees in Tarangire National Park, and breathtaking views of Mount Kilimanjaro. As the scenery shifts from one region to another, your safari feels dynamic and immersive, rather than repetitive, which adds depth to the entire experience.

Authentic Safari Experience

Furthermore, Tanzania preserves a genuine safari atmosphere that many destinations no longer offer. Because large conservation areas limit crowd density, you enjoy quieter game drives and more personal wildlife encounters. At the same time, parks like Nyerere National Park introduce unique activities such as walking safaris and boat safaris, which bring you closer to nature in a meaningful way. Therefore, you connect with the environment more deeply and experience Africa in its most authentic form.

Perfect Safari and Beach Combination

Finally, Tanzania allows you to combine adventure with relaxation in a seamless way. After exciting days in the wild, you can head to Zanzibar, where white sandy beaches and turquoise waters create a peaceful contrast. Not only do you unwind by the ocean, but you also explore rich cultural heritage in historic Stone Town. As a result, your journey feels complete, since you balance thrilling safari moments with calm, tropical escape.
